Good things to know
Which word is more common?
Detachment is more commonly used than decoupling in everyday language. Detachment is versatile and covers a wide range of personal and emotional contexts, while decoupling is more technical and business-oriented.
What’s the difference in the tone of formality between decoupling and detachment?
While decoupling is typically associated with a formal and technical tone, detachment is more versatile and can be employed in both formal and informal contexts, allowing it to be used in personal and emotional contexts as well.
